Space Odyssey
I doubt that there is someone who hasn’t dreamt of being on the board of a spaceship. If you like stories about intergalactic adventures, it's mandatory for you to visit Sin City. Julian Tahov has designed the interior of the club and it makes you feel as if you were real cosmic travelers. Here gravity seems to be overcome by the objects that seem to be floating in the air. This has been achieved by the designer's use of his favourite technique featuring mirror surfaces.
Sinners is a modern nightclub with several bars and distinct corners where you can rest with a drink, have a chat with your friends or simply observe what's happening around you. Altogether with the lobby bar Vouge the new club spreads on about 600 square meters. The interior is dominated by the aggressive but stylish combination of red and black, typical for the whole complex. The club is marked by what is typical for Julian Tahov's style: a saturation of the atmosphere with details adding perspective to the space. Wherever you turn, your eyes rest upon features unnoticed prior to that moment. ”This is one of the most important tasks that I set before I start project.That's the only way for the space to look different and for you not to get bored with it”, says the designer.

Spheres, hemispheres, spirals, polished surfaces, shining stripes complement the futuristic atmosphere of Sinners. The light effects are designed with a purpose and underline the visitor's sensation for surreality and reverse perspective. You however must see it yourselves to believe it...
"Juilan Tahov will design the newest discotheque of the Planeta Payner Club chain”
The newest discotheque of the Planeta Payner Club chain will see its opening in Plovdiv for St. Valentine's Day. It's an ambitious project with the prospect to be the largest disco club of the chain with its area of over 700 square meters and a capacity for 800 – 1000 visitors.
Designer Julian Tahov is the artist who created the avant-garde interior. Here, like in Sofia's Sin City club, it all gets down to his choice of frosted and mirror surfaces, sphere and hemispheres and contrasting colors which provoke and lift up your spirits.
The official opening will be in February with an elegant cocktail party where elite Payner stars will show up as well. The visitors will have the chance to check out the perfect quality of the sound, a result of the sound-absorbing materials used in furnishing the hall.
